1. What is a Powerball?
Powerball is the world’s fastest hand-held gyroscope capable of spinning at speeds in excess of 16,00RPM
2. How do you Start Powerball?
Initially you start Powerball with the string provided but you should soon master the “finger start”
3. Who benefits from using a Powerball?
Powerball is a fantastic hand and arm exercise device ideal for golfers, tennis players, squash & badminton players, kite fliers, guitar players, rock climbers, water skiers, bowlers, drummers, and just about anybody who could use more strength in their hands and arms

5. What’s the best way of spinning Powerball?
By using smooth hand rotations you can gradually build your revolution to an incredible speed in excess of 16,000 RPM!
6. What does the counter do?
The counter has a number of cool features, one of which is the high score recorder which consistently shows the highest score the ball has ever achieved.
